Isn't this a little expensive for 8 used miners?

-$5k divided by 8 is $625 for a used miner and psu (the psu I am assuming is shared since its a 1200w). Shipping is not necessarily included, depending on where you live.

-bitmain is .893 BTC (currently BTC is at $487.01) = $434.81 and if you order a corsair 850 for ~$80-~$100 that brings the price to maybe $534 shipped for new ones.

Which means I could pick up 8 for no more then $4200 shipped for new ones.



Not to thread crap, but you are charging almost $100 more per miner for used equipment, which we have no idea how long they have been running, if they have been overclocked (which means they work harder), etc.

I think if you want to sell these, you need to lower your price according to used, not brand new (plus a premium).

As far as the equipment goes, the only other piece I did not factor in is cat 5, and maybe a switch (total less then $100).

As far as missed mining goes, that is true, i did not include that in the numbers, with 8 machines running, for 7 days, about 2 btc at the current difficulty. So that is about $1,000 minus electricity costs.

And configuration... that is extremely easy for these, so maybe 10-15 minutes of ones times, if you have never done it before. So I hardly would factor that in for the evaluation.

And overnight is great... but for this many machines, the costs are going to run someone a few hundred dollars based on the size and weight of these machines (if located in the United States).

So for the amount of time you lose mining by ordering thru Bitmain, and the cost of shipping, it would be slightly cheaper to order thru Bitmain (even with the missed mining time). However, you could always order thru his distributor in the US, who ships within 2 days via 3-5 day shipping included. They also offer overnight for a fee. And his prices on miners are also 0.893 btc. Therefore, that would be the "cheaper" route if you wanted it overnight or faster then bitmain. They would also be new units as opposed to used units for an unspecified amount of time.
